Cessna A188 AGwagon G-BANH at Skipsea.

During the afternoon of Sunday, 20th May 1973 this aircraft was being flown between Northumberland and Norwich when the pilot made a successful forced landing at Skipsea in poor visibility and also in the presence of a thunderstorm. The aircraft was undamaged and resume flight the next day. The aircraft was owned by Mindacre Ltd, of Grimsby, who undertook crop spraying in the Summer months in various parts of the country.

Pilot - Mr Roy Clarke.
